Most of the controls we talk about with Perth clients - email security, endpoint protection, staff training - deal with a threat after it's already reached someone's inbox or device. DNS filtering works earlier than that. It stops the connection to a malicious website before it ever loads, which makes it one of the cheapest, least disruptive controls a business can add.
What DNS filtering actually does
Every time a device visits a website, it first performs a DNS lookup - translating a domain name like example.com into the IP address the browser then connects to. DNS filtering intercepts that lookup and checks it against a continuously updated threat intelligence database before letting it resolve.
If the domain is known to host phishing pages, malware, or command-and-control infrastructure for compromised devices, the lookup is blocked and the user sees a warning page instead of the malicious site. The browser never connects to the actual server.
Why it matters even with email filtering and antivirus in place
Email security stops most malicious links from ever reaching an inbox, but not all of them - and staff also click links from text messages, chat apps, social media, and search results that email filtering has no visibility into. DNS filtering catches that traffic regardless of where the link came from.
It also blocks a device that's already been compromised - by malware installed through some other means - from phoning home to its command-and-control server, which is often what turns a minor infection into a full ransomware incident. Cutting that communication channel can stop an attack from progressing even after the initial compromise has happened.
A typical scenario
A staff member receives a text message - not an email - with a link claiming to be from Australia Post about a missed delivery. It gets past every email control because it never touched email. They click it. With DNS filtering in place, the domain resolves to a block page instead of a credential-harvesting site, because the domain was already flagged in the threat database. Without it, they land on a convincing fake login page.
What else DNS filtering can do
Beyond security blocking, most platforms also support content category filtering - useful for businesses that want to restrict access to gambling, adult content, or social media on work devices, or that need it for compliance reasons (schools and NDIS providers in particular). This is a policy decision separate from the security case, and worth configuring deliberately rather than defaulting to either extreme.
Common DNS filtering platforms
- FortiGuard Web Filtering - built into FortiGate firewalls many Perth businesses already run for their firewall, often no extra licensing cost
- Microsoft Defender for Business - includes web protection for Microsoft 365 Business Premium customers, covering devices even off the office network
- Cisco Umbrella / DNSFilter - dedicated DNS filtering platforms with more granular reporting and policy control, better suited to larger or multi-site businesses
- Cloudflare Gateway - a lightweight, low-cost option that works well for smaller teams
Getting it configured properly
DNS filtering is only effective if it can't be bypassed. The common gaps we find in existing setups:
- Filtering only applied at the router - a device can bypass it entirely by manually changing its DNS settings unless enforcement happens at the firewall or via an endpoint agent
- DNS-over-HTTPS (DoH) left open - modern browsers can encrypt DNS lookups to a third-party resolver, sidestepping filtering unless DoH to unapproved resolvers is explicitly blocked
- Remote and laptop devices not covered - filtering configured only for the office network does nothing for a laptop working from a cafe or home, unless it's enforced via an agent on the device itself
- No visibility into what's being blocked - without reviewing logs occasionally, a business has no way to know whether the filtering is catching real attempts or just sitting there unused
What does DNS filtering cost?
- Included in existing licensing - many Perth businesses already have web filtering available through FortiGate or Microsoft 365 Business Premium at no extra cost, just not switched on
- Dedicated platforms - $2-$5 per user per month for standalone DNS filtering with reporting and category controls
- Setup and policy configuration - typically a few hours of one-off work to configure categories, exceptions, and enforcement across devices

Does DNS filtering replace antivirus or a firewall?
No - it's one layer in a layered defence, not a replacement for endpoint protection or a firewall. DNS filtering stops a specific class of threat (malicious domains) before connection. It doesn't inspect files, detect malware already on a device, or replace email security. It's most valuable alongside those tools, not instead of them.
Can staff bypass DNS filtering?
Basic DNS filtering configured only at the router level can be bypassed by changing a device's DNS settings or using DNS-over-HTTPS (DoH) in a browser. Proper business deployments enforce filtering at the firewall or via an endpoint agent, and block DoH to third-party resolvers, so it can't be sidestepped by changing a setting.
